淘金网币圈快讯 > 币圈资源 > 红币行情-持续测试(CT)实战经验分享

红币行情-持续测试(CT)实战经验分享

币圈快讯 币圈资源 2022年07月30日

  看虚拟币行情的网站币圈惨案

  趋势的推动下向“新四化◇○▲”,构向域集中式架构发展传统分布式的EE架■▽,器概念的提出伴随着域控制,应功能域分类集成软件也将根据相□▪,码量也与日俱增域控制器的代。各软件功能模块间解耦SOA的开发模式实现,缩短开发周期帮助软件团队,软件版本快速迭代。币圈资源快速部署到各个域控制器OTA升级技术将软件□--,速迭代提供保障为软件产品的快。模式的变革随着开发,周期短而频繁迭代测试变得,品提供快速的质量保证持续测试将为软件产◇○。

  的CI(持续集成)- CO(持续部署) - CT(持续测试)- CD(持续交付)持续测试来源于DevOps(Development和Operations)中提倡◁▷,/持续测试工具平台通过流程和持续集成,软件交付”自动化“■-●,能够更加快捷、频繁和可靠使得构建=□◇、测试、发布软件★○-。

红币行情-持续测试(CT)实战经验分享

  件开发模型中传统汽车软•◁,测试脚本后的自动化/半自动化测试测试方法包括手动测试和手动编写▲-。“人”为中心其特点是以,测试脚本或配置、记录测试问题和测试状态跟踪需要测试工程师重复性的手动测试、不断更新■▷□。期和质量测试的周,量、经验能力和工具数量依赖于测试工程师的数…■▼。

  试流程、测试工具的结合持续测试的方法以人、测,组合与自动化测试工程结合通过一系列测试工具链的,为测试流程的开始提交新版软件时即,软件缺陷快速找到,在时间上的矛盾解决测试和开发,件产品速度与质量的目标帮助软件开发团队实现软。

  务管理模块、测试缺陷管理模块、测试报告管理模块■…○、远程设备管理模块• 测试项目管理模块、测试需求管理模块、测试用例管理模块、测试任等

  个环节和流程自动地、智能地组织起来持续测试的核心在于把自动化测试的各,询、通知等服务并提供状态查,骤如下实现步☆□◇:

  开发人员提交状态•测试触发:监控☆▪●,为测试开始提交结束即,s管理测试执行的流采用Jenkin程

  工程代替测试工程师手动执行测试•数据采集和分析:用自动化测试,测试周期既缩短==-,生的误测漏测等问题又避免了人工测试产;试数据分析测▪☆•,报告与测试问题自动生成测试,入测试问题的重复性劳避免测试工程师手动录动

  程、测试报告、测试数据与软件版本相对应•测试报告版本管理▽●:测试用例◆…●、测试工,题追溯与定方便测试问位

  NK或者JIRA等测试管理软件建立测试计划•测试计划建立:使用北汇自研PAVELI,件版本信息包含测试软,用例库测试▷=●,责任人测试等

  与测试样件进行测试环境调试•测试环境搭建:测试设备○★•,动化测试以支持自。总线接口设备和CANoe软测试工具使用Vector件

  ins Job进行配置管理自动化测试流程通过Jenk•▽▷。/SVN版本或通过Jenkins API触发调用等方式触发Jenkins Job可通过手动、定时、监控GitLab•▲。测试样件软件版本本次方案通过监控,级到指定版本后读取到软件升,调度方式触发测试流程的开始使用Jenkins API□□○。

  测试用例工程的选择、测试执行、测试数据和测试结果的回读测试执行:通过CANoe软件COM接口调用的方式实现。

  果自动上传到测试问题管理系统测试问题记录:回读到的测试结,K平台更新测试用例的测试结果使用北汇自研的PAVELIN,和新建测试问题上传测试数据。

  具有邮件发送功能Jenkins,行结束时在测试执☆-△,过邮件发送给相关责任人可将测试结果等信息通。

  同于自动化测试持续测试不等,一系列流程持续测试,动化测试包含自,测试的一个关键步骤自动化测试是持续。迭代在流程上结合通过和软件开发□★□,软件缺陷快速发现▽●。

  好地将解决手动测试周期长的问题采用持续测试的测试方式可以很,测试效率提升了,员的生产力提高测试人。软件开发版本进行控制同时对测试输出物与,测试管理的要求符合正向开发和。

  升测试效率的工具持续测试作为可提,式”托管执行测试的工作体验的确给测试工程师带来★▽“一键。工具而言但作为,足所有的测试场景持续测试并不能满。先首••,试用例是可自动化执行的持续测试要求可执行的测■•◁,行参数输入或测试环境的变更测试过程中如果需要手动进,测试效率的效果很难达到提升▪•。次其•△=,成或测试脚本不需要修改需要测试脚本可自动生,代的软件产品面对每次迭,会给测试人员带来繁重的工作量手动编写或者修改测试工程也。

  工具链多且复杂持续测试使用的◆★,定性需要重点关注测试系统整体的稳。要先对测试场景进行分析所以是否进行持续测试需•△▷,而去舍弃测试的精确性也不能为了追求持续性。

  跟市场风向北汇信息紧,积累了很多的经验在持续测试方面也▷•▲,ns的持续测试方案除了基于Jenki,Noe软件的测试管理工具北汇信息也自研了基于CA▪•□,红币行情的同仁进行交流期待与行业中▪□★。

标签: 红币行情